Abstract
The utility model relates to a kind of air-flow crushers with hermetic seal protection, including motor, motor copper sheathing, main shaft, grading wheel, crushing chamber and gas passage for high-pressure air source, the main shaft and grading wheel are set in the crushing chamber, one end of motor copper sheathing is connect with the motor, the other end of motor copper sheathing extends to the crushing chamber, one end of main shaft is connected to motor through the motor copper sheathing, the other end of main shaft is connect with the grading wheel, gas passage passes through broken chamber outer wall and motor copper sheathing is communicated with the cavity of crushing chamber, there is spacing between the main shaft and motor copper sheathing, the outside of the main shaft is successively arranged axle sleeve and sealing shroud from the inside to the outside, the axle sleeve and the main shaft are interference fitted, the sealing shroud and the axle sleeve are interference fitted.The air-flow crusher sealing effect of the utility model is good, not will cause material and accumulates in motor copper sheathing and gap of main reinforcement, the abrasion of main shaft can be greatly reduced, improves the service life of main shaft.

Background technique
Generally there are imperceptible gaps between the motor copper sheathing and main shaft of existing air-flow crusher, when machine run starts
Moment, cavity internal pressure increase, cause micro mist material to be blown into the gap between motor copper sheathing and main shaft, make to electric machine main shaft
At abrasion, especially when air-flow crusher be used to carry out superhard material it is broken when, superhard material enters motor copper sheathing and main shaft
Between gap after serious abrasion is caused to electric machine main shaft, cause crusher that cannot run well.Furthermore main shaft is close to classification
Wheel part is generally sealed using 304 stainless steels, when carry out superhard material it is broken when, 304 stainless steel sealing shrouds are easily ground
Damage.

When work, high-pressure air source is entered by gas passage 6 in the cavity of crushing chamber 5, the main shaft 3 and motor copper sheathing 2
Between have a spacing, the outside of the main shaft 3 is successively arranged axle sleeve 31 and sealing shroud 32, the axle sleeve 31 and the master from the inside to the outside
Axis 3 is interference fitted, and the sealing shroud 32 is interference fitted with the axle sleeve 31, prevents material heap in motor copper sheathing and gap of main reinforcement
Product, can be greatly reduced the abrasion of main shaft, improves the service life of main shaft.Preferably, high-pressure air source passes through gas path pipe, motor copper
It covers inlet channel 61 and enters the first hermetic seal channel 62 and the second hermetic seal channel 63, be then blown into the cavity of crushing chamber 5, institute
It successively includes the first sealing shroud 321 and the second sealing shroud 322 that sealing shroud 32, which is stated, from nearly motor side to remote motor extreme direction, and first is close
Big envelope 321 and the second sealing shroud 322 are integral and internal diameter is consistent with the outer diameter of the second axle sleeve 312, outside the first sealing shroud 321
Outer diameter of the diameter less than the second sealing shroud 322, nearly first axle sleeve, 311 end of the first sealing shroud 321 and nearly the first of the first axle sleeve 311
321 end of sealing shroud interference fit, so that the path that gas is blown into is turned by the direction of the direction grading wheel in the first hermetic seal channel 62
It is changed to point to the intracorporal direction of 5 chamber of crushing chamber, high-pressure air source is blown by the first hermetic seal channel 62 and the second hermetic seal channel 63
Enter in the cavity of crushing chamber, prevents material from entering the gap between motor copper sheathing and sealing shroud, avoid material to sealing shroud and copper
The abrasion of set, meanwhile, change the direction of the gas blown out in hermetic seal channel, material is made not blow to grading wheel directly, has and protect
Protect the effect of grading wheel.
